The Global Headquarters for Volvo Financial Services is seeking a Data Analyst for the Global D&IT Data Team.

What you will do

As a Data Analyst, you will work closely with our business teams to understand their needs and transform them into actionable, fit-for-purpose data products. These products which are owned by the business, will be supported by you from data collection and analysis to visualization and reporting, ensuring they adhere to the agreed requirements.

  • Collaborating with business stakeholders and team members to understand requirements and support data-driven solutions.
  • Designing, developing, and maintaining reports, dashboards, and data products using Power BI, SQL, and Azure data services.
  • Supporting the accuracy, reliability, and consistency of data products aligned with business objectives.
  • Participating in data analysis, visualization, and reporting activities to deliver actionable insights.
  • Contributing to continuous improvements in reporting, data quality, and analytical processes.
  • Communicating findings and recommendations clearly to both business and IT stakeholders.
  • Supporting data governance activities, including data quality and consistency initiatives.

Your future team

You will report directly to the Manager, Data Quality and Products within VFS D&IT and will be assigned to a stable, global cross-functional team. As the captive finance arm of the Volvo Group, VFS provides financial services and solutions that meet the needs of our customers’ evolving business. Through our dedication to innovation, we support society in its adoption of sustainable transport and equipment solutions. VFS is headquartered inGothenburg, Sweden, and serves Volvo Group customers and dealers in more than 50 markets.
